ARM Cortex-M3 Processor Core
2 ARM Cortex-M3 Processor Core
The ARM Cortex-M3 processor provides the core for a high-performance, low-cost platform that
meets the needs of minimal memory implementation, reduced pin count, and low power
consumption, while delivering outstanding computational performance and exceptional system
response to interrupts. Features include:
 Compact core.
 Thumb-2 instruction set, delivering the high-performance expected of an ARM core in the
memory size usually associated with 8- and 16-bit devices; typically in the range of a few
kilobytes of memory for microcontroller class applications.
 Exceptional interrupt handling, by implementing the register manipulations required for
handling an interrupt in hardware.
 Memory protection unit (MPU) to provide a privileged mode of operation for complex
applications.
 Full-featured debug solution with a:
â Serial Wire JTAG Debug Port (SWJ-DP)
â Flash Patch and Breakpoint (FPB) unit for implementing breakpoints
â Data Watchpoint and Trigger (DWT) unit for implementing watchpoints, trigger resources,
and system profiling
â Instrumentation Trace Macrocell (ITM) for support of printf style debugging
â Trace Port Interface Unit (TPIU) for bridging to a Trace Port Analyzer
The Stellaris family of microcontrollers builds on this core to bring high-performance 32-bit
computing to cost-sensitive embedded microcontroller applications, such as factory automation
and control, industrial control power devices, building and home automation.
